Metallographic sample preparation report of Mo-TiC20%
2022-03-14
Molybdenum is a refractory metal, which has the characteristics of high melting point, high temperature strength, good thermal conductivity and electrical conductivity, low thermal expansion coefficient, resistance to corrosion by molten salts and liquid light metals. Molybdenum and its alloys are commonly used in powder metallurgy processes. Molybdenum powders doped with specific elements and compounds can be pressed and sintered to form high-strength metal products.

02 Sample preparation procedure
1-Mounting
After ultrasonic cleaning of the specimens, hot mounting the specimen with FlexPRESS mounting press.
FlexPRESS mounting press
Equipment | FlexPRESS mounting press |
Consumables | TJ2237 edge retention epoxy resin |
Parameter | 180℃,160Bar,4min,medium speed cooling |
2- Grinding
Polish the specimen with Alpha -600 automatic grinder&polisher, diamond grinding disc P120→P1500.

Equipment | Alpha-600 automatic grinder&polisher |
Consumables | Diamond grinding disc:P120,P400,P1500 |
Parameter | Upper disc:100rpm,lower disc:300rpm,same direction,pressure:25N |
3.1-Polishing(plane polishing)
Polish the specimen with Alpha-600 automatic grinder&polisher,use YS polishing cloth with 3μm polycrystalline diamond suspension for plane polishing. Note that PL-W polishing lubricant should be added for polishing.

Equipment | Alpha-600 automatic grinder&polisher |
Consumables | YS polishing cloth,3μm polycrystalline diamond suspension,PL-Wpolishing lubricant |
Parameter | Upper disc:100rpm,lower disc:150rpm,reverse direction,pressure:25N,time:10min |
3.2-polishing(fine polishing)
Polish the specimen with Alpha-600 automatic grinder&polisher,use ZN polishing cloth with 0.05μm non-crystallizing silica suspension for fine polishing.(add 3% hydrogen peroxide in non-crystallizing silica suspension)

Equipment | Alpha-600 automatic grinder&polisher |
Consumables | ZN-ZP black polyurethane polishing cloth,0.05μm non-crystallizing silica suspension(add 30% hydrogen peroxide) |
Parameter | Upper disc:100rpm,lower disc:120rpm,same direction,pressure:20N,time :5~10min |
4- Corrosion
After 10min polishing with non-crystallizing silica suspension, The general outline of each phase in the sample has been revealed (see the figure below),Just need to corrode a little.

| Reagent | 15% potassium ferricyanide and 15% sodium hydroxide aqueous solution are mixed in a ratio of 2:1 |
Instructions | Abrasion method, time:5~10s | |

03 Analysis
Mo-TiC 500×
Visible light blue TiC, black holes, white molybdenum and other equiaxed grains
Mo is a hard and tough metal. In this example, Mo and TiC are sintered, and the hardness of TiC is about 3400HV, which is much higher than 2550HV of SiC. Therefore, SiC sandpaper should not be used for grinding this metal. It should be replaced with diamond grinding disc.
Plane polishing is relatively simple, use a hard woven cloth with polycrystalline diamond suspension.
During fine polishing, use a soft damped polishing cloth for chemical mechanical polishing to release the stress on the surface of the sample, and pay attention to controlling the time to avoid too much embossing for phases with different hardnesses.
After silica polishing, since the stress on the surface of the sample is released to a large extent, the subsequent etching becomes extremely simple, and the etchant can be used to slightly rub for a few seconds. Pay attention to protection, the corrosive liquid is poisonous!
In the metallographic phase, the light blue is TiC, the black is the hole, and the white is the molybdenum equiaxed grain. The dark area around TiC should be the diffusion and fusion area of TiC and Mo.
Referring to GB-T 41080-2021 "Molybdenum and molybdenum alloy metallographic examination methods" 9.2 grain assessment of 9.2.1 appendix B of the comparative method, the grain size of molybdenum is at or better than M10 grade.
